- [ ] **Podcast feed validator (Castlereach):** Confirm the validator rejects malformed episode GUIDs and enclosure URLs, and that the weekly failure report actually reaches the content team. Spot-check three recent feeds flagged as clean. Any discrepancies raised at this week's sync should be routed to the owner listed below.

named custodian: Brivan Eliath Quenox Frador

Ticket: order-cutoff rule fires an hour early for plugin-created orders. If your plugin submits to Crumbline's bakery API after 6pm shop-local time, the cutoff validator rejects it even though the shop's configured cutoff is 7pm — looks like we're comparing against UTC-offset-naive timestamps. Workaround for now: pass the timezone explicitly in the order payload. We'll patch the core validator next sprint. When reporting repros, please attach the build token printed below.

pipeline stamp: htk3_69f

## Limits and Quotas — Striderline Chip Reader

Each Striderline mat antenna decodes a bounded number of chip pings per second; beyond that, reads are dropped silently, not queued. During peak waves (start line, finish chute) expect bursts near the ceiling. If drop counters climb, throttle the upstream splits feed before touching firmware. The enforced quotas per reader unit are as follows.

limits module of yahif-tawif:
BUDGETS = {
    "ulays": 902,
    "kelael": 492,
    "ralix": 488,
    "oliok": 420,
    "wenmir": 757,
    "casath": 178,
    "eliir": 272,
}

If autocomplete latency on Lexhaven exceeds 400ms, the suffix index on node pool B is usually stale. Trigger a rebuild via the Quillcast admin endpoint and watch the compaction queue drain before re-enabling traffic. Rebuilds take roughly twenty minutes. Authenticate the rebuild call against the Quillcast control plane using the key below.

API key for yahig-tadup: kto7_ubizbYm